Well I have a 65 gl tank with about 18 tetras in it and the water the other day went cloudy and now I'm having issue with trying to get it to clear; I have lost several fish and I cant seem to g4et the Ammonia level down; I was feeding a lot I believe and I have take out about 5 gl of water; should I take out more? Is there anything I can do to bring the Ammonia level down befoe I loose more fish?

Answer
Hello,

I recommend syphoning your gravel, cleaning your filter media and continuing with regular water changes. This will not only clear up your aquarium, but it should help reduce ammonia as well. You may also want to buy a product called Cycle, which helps the nitrogen cycle complete iteself, therefore reducing ammonia.
